Plug Power’s stock surged 60% following record hydrogen production at its Georgia plant. This pivotal news underlines growing investor confidence in green hydrogen’s role in sustainable energy.

Plug Power’s Strategic Expansion

The recent surge in Plug Power’s stock price is closely linked to its strategic expansion in the green hydrogen sector. The Georgia plant, a cornerstone of this expansion, has achieved a record production of 324 metric tons of green hydrogen, reflecting the company’s commitment and capacity to meet growing energy demands sustainably [1][8].

Investor Confidence and Institutional Backing

Investor confidence has skyrocketed, supported by a $1.66 billion loan guarantee from the U.S. Department of Energy. This financial backing has positioned Plug Power as a formidable player in the U.S. green hydrogen economy, further bolstered by Norges Bank increasing its stake to 7.95% [8].

Financial Performance and Market Volatility

Despite historical volatility, with stock prices ranging from 69 cents to $3.32 over the past year, Plug Power’s recent performance shows promise. The stock’s recent rise from around $1.50 to nearly $2.40 marks a 60% increase, showcasing renewed market enthusiasm and potential stability in a previously turbulent sector [1].

Future Prospects and Strategic Initiatives

Looking ahead, Plug Power’s strategic initiatives, such as Project Quantum Leap, aim to cut costs by $150–200 million annually, addressing operational inefficiencies. This initiative is expected to enhance profitability margins, making Plug Power’s green hydrogen strategy even more robust and appealing to investors [8].
